Permanent representative: Question on Libya to be on agenda of Russia-NATO Council

The question of resolving the situation in Libya will be included in the agenda of the next meeting of NATO-Russia Council (NRC) at the ambassadorial level at the end of March in Brussels, Russia's permanent representative to NATO Dmitry Rogozin said on Wednesday, RIA Novosti reported.

"It (the meeting) will take place at the end of the month. Date is now clarified, most likely, it will be 29. The issue of Libya will be included in the agenda as well," the ambassador said in an interview with RIA Novosti.

The NRC had previously discussed the situation in Libya, but the question then was not on the agenda of the meeting.
